Hi Fred ---

I agree with you. I think Michelle's biggest ally in this is her husband. If there is no real financial pressure to succeed right away, then she has the time to ramp up. Maybe even do a small volunteer application for a charity or church where she can get some practical experience in use cases, CRC, OOAD, and general consultancy issues.



> I agree with John Harvey for the most part. However, mastering is a relative term. It's My Opinion that a consultants should feel confident in what ever development tools they are using before stating that they provide consulting services with them. My first VB contract was to produce a guest login/logout tracking system for a manufacturing plant. A user could pull a list and see who was in plant and who left plant in case of emergency. It took a day to write and a very simplistic knowledge of VB.
